About the role
- As an Data Center Technician, you will play a vital role in maintaining and optimizing the IT infrastructure within our data center.
- This includes working hands-on with modern technologies such as the advanced H200 GPU cloud cluster.
- You're welcome to work in our colocation in Vineland, New Jersey.
Responsibilities
- Diagnosing and resolving issues related to IT hardware and ensure the continuous support of the data center's IT infrastructure.
- Planning, executing and monitoring regular IT tasks to maintain and improve IT infrastructure operations.
- Lead and manage (specific workflows, processes, projects).
Requirements
- 3+ years of hands-on experience in diagnosing and resolving server hardware issues.
- Basic proficiency in the Linux operating system and familiarity with command-line tools.
- Excel skills, including proficiency with pivot tables, formulas, lists and graph creation.
